What Types of Hard Water Filters Are Suitable for Sinks?

The best types of hard water filters suitable for sinks include various systems designed to effectively reduce mineral content and improve water quality.

  • Faucet-Mounted Filters: These filters attach directly to the faucet and provide a convenient way to filter water on demand.
  • Under-Sink Reverse Osmosis Systems: These systems are installed beneath the sink and use a multi-stage filtration process to remove hard minerals as well as other contaminants.
  • Water Softeners: Water softeners are designed specifically to remove calcium and magnesium ions from hard water, replacing them with sodium ions.
  • Pitcher Filters: Although less common for sink applications, pitcher filters can be used for smaller needs and are portable and easy to use.

Faucet-Mounted Filters: These filters are popular for their ease of installation and use. They typically feature a switch that allows you to choose between filtered and unfiltered water, ensuring versatility for various uses in the kitchen.

Under-Sink Reverse Osmosis Systems: This option is considered one of the most effective for removing hard water minerals, as well as other impurities like chlorine and heavy metals. Installation can be more complex, but the resulting clean water is ideal for drinking and cooking.

Water Softeners: By using a process known as ion exchange, these systems effectively reduce hardness in water, which can help prevent scale buildup in plumbing and appliances. They require salt for regeneration and may need periodic maintenance but provide long-lasting benefits for household water quality.

Pitcher Filters: While they may not filter large quantities of water, pitcher filters are a convenient and cost-effective option for those who want to improve their drinking water quality without permanent installation. They typically use activated carbon to reduce chlorine taste and odor, although they may not be as effective against hard water minerals.

How Do Reverse Osmosis Systems Work for Hard Water?

Reverse osmosis systems are effective solutions for treating hard water by removing minerals and contaminants through a multi-stage filtration process.

  • Pre-Filtration: The initial stage of reverse osmosis involves pre-filters that remove larger particles, sediments, and chlorine from the water. This step is crucial as it protects the RO membrane from damage and extends the lifespan of the system.
  • Reverse Osmosis Membrane: This is the core component of the system where the actual filtration takes place. The semi-permeable membrane allows only water molecules to pass through while blocking heavy minerals like calcium and magnesium, which are responsible for hard water.
  • Post-Filtration: After the water has passed through the RO membrane, it goes through a post-filter which polishes the water, enhancing its taste and ensuring any remaining impurities are removed. This ensures that the water is not only free of hardness minerals but also clean and palatable.
  • Storage Tank: Treated water is stored in a separate tank until needed, allowing for a consistent supply of filtered water. This tank is usually pressurized, providing a convenient way to draw water when needed.
  • Faucet and Dispensing System: The final stage involves a dedicated faucet installed at the sink, from which the filtered water is dispensed. This design keeps the RO system separate from the main water supply, ensuring that users have easy access to high-quality water without contamination.

What Are the Benefits of Using a Water Softener?

The benefits of using a water softener include improved water quality, reduced appliance wear, and enhanced soap efficiency.

  • Improved Water Quality: Water softeners effectively remove hard minerals such as calcium and magnesium, which can lead to a smoother feel and taste in your drinking water. Softened water is less likely to leave deposits on fixtures and glassware, providing a clearer and more appealing result.
  • Reduced Appliance Wear: Hard water can cause scale buildup in appliances like dishwashers, water heaters, and washing machines, leading to decreased efficiency and shortened lifespans. By using a water softener, you can significantly prolong the life of these appliances and reduce maintenance costs.
  • Enhanced Soap Efficiency: Hard water can inhibit the effectiveness of soaps and detergents, often requiring more product to achieve the same cleaning results. With softened water, soap lathers more easily, leading to better cleaning performance and potential savings on cleaning supplies.
  • Healthier Skin and Hair: Softened water can be gentler on skin and hair, reducing dryness and irritation that hard water can cause. Many users report healthier, shinier hair and softer skin after switching to a water softener.
  • Lower Energy Bills: By reducing scale buildup in appliances and pipes, water softeners can improve overall efficiency, which may lead to lower energy consumption and reduced utility bills over time. This can be particularly beneficial for households with high water usage.

How Effective Are Faucet-Mounted Filters for Hard Water?

Faucet-mounted filters can be effective for hard water, but their performance can vary based on several factors.

  • Filtration Technology: Different faucet-mounted filters utilize various technologies such as activated carbon, reverse osmosis, or ion exchange. Activated carbon filters primarily reduce chlorine and improve taste but might not significantly affect hardness minerals, while reverse osmosis systems can effectively remove a broader range of contaminants, including some hardness elements.
  • Removal Efficiency: The effectiveness of a faucet filter in removing hardness depends on its capability to target calcium and magnesium ions. Many filters are not specifically designed for hard water, so it’s essential to check the filter specifications and certifications to ensure they address hardness levels adequately.
  • Flow Rate and Capacity: Faucet-mounted filters typically have lower flow rates and limited capacity compared to whole-house systems. This means they might require more frequent replacement or may not provide enough filtered water for high-demand uses, which can be a disadvantage for households with significant hard water issues.
  • Installation and Maintenance: These filters are generally easy to install and maintain, making them a convenient option for renters or those looking for temporary solutions. However, regular maintenance, such as changing the filter cartridge, is crucial for optimal performance, which can be a hassle if not managed properly.
  • Cost-Effectiveness: Faucet-mounted filters are usually more affordable upfront than whole-house systems, making them an attractive option for those looking to mitigate hard water issues without a significant investment. However, the cumulative cost of replacing cartridges over time may make them less economical for long-term use compared to more permanent solutions.

What Features Are Essential When Choosing a Hard Water Filter?

When choosing the best hard water filter for a sink, several essential features should be considered to ensure effective performance and user satisfaction.

  • Filtration Method: The filtration method determines how effectively the filter can remove minerals and contaminants from water. Common methods include reverse osmosis, ion exchange, and activated carbon, each offering distinct advantages in terms of purification levels and maintenance requirements.
  • Flow Rate: The flow rate is critical as it indicates how quickly the filtered water can be dispensed. A higher flow rate allows for quicker access to filtered water, which is particularly important for households with higher water needs, ensuring that the filter does not impede daily activities.
  • Filter Lifespan: Knowing the lifespan of the filter cartridge is essential for planning maintenance and ensuring consistent water quality. Longer-lasting filters can reduce the frequency and cost of replacements, making them more convenient for regular use.
  • Size and Design: The size and design of the filter should fit comfortably under the sink or in the designated area without taking up excessive space. A compact design can be beneficial in homes with limited under-sink space and should also be aesthetically pleasing to match kitchen decor.
  • Installation and Maintenance: Easy installation and low maintenance requirements are significant advantages. Filters that can be installed without professional help save time and money, while those that require minimal upkeep encourage regular use and effective performance over time.
  • Certification: Look for filters that are certified by reputable organizations, such as NSF International, which ensures they meet specific safety and performance standards. Certifications provide assurance that the filter effectively reduces hard water minerals and other contaminants, offering peace of mind to users.
  • Cost: The initial purchase price of the filter, along with ongoing costs for replacement cartridges and maintenance, should align with your budget. While higher-priced filters may offer advanced features, it’s essential to evaluate the overall value in terms of performance and longevity.

What Capacity and Flow Rate Do You Need for Daily Use?

When selecting the best hard water filter for your sink, it is essential to consider the capacity and flow rate that suits your daily needs.

  • Filter Capacity: This refers to how much water the filter can process before needing a replacement or maintenance.
  • Flow Rate: This indicates the speed at which water can pass through the filter, typically measured in gallons per minute (GPM).
  • Daily Water Consumption: Understanding your household’s daily water usage is crucial for choosing the right filter.
  • Filter Type: Different types of filters offer varying capacities and flow rates depending on their technology and design.

Filter Capacity: The filter capacity is significant because it determines how long the filter can effectively remove hard water minerals before it needs to be replaced. This could range from a few hundred gallons to several thousand, depending on the model. Choosing a filter with a suitable capacity ensures that you won’t frequently need to invest in replacements, thus saving time and money.

Flow Rate: The flow rate is crucial for everyday convenience, as it affects how quickly you can fill containers or use water for cooking and cleaning. A higher flow rate typically means less waiting time, which is particularly important in busy households. Most hard water filters have flow rates ranging from 0.5 to 2 GPM, and selecting one that meets your needs can greatly enhance your experience.

Daily Water Consumption: Assessing your household’s daily water consumption helps you determine the appropriate filter capacity and flow rate. If your family uses a lot of water for cooking, cleaning, or drinking, you’ll likely need a filter with a higher capacity and flow rate to keep up with demand. Monitoring your usage patterns can help you make a more informed choice.

Filter Type: The type of filter you choose can greatly influence both capacity and flow rate. For instance, reverse osmosis systems typically have lower flow rates but high filtration capabilities, while carbon filters may offer faster flow rates but less comprehensive filtration. Understanding the pros and cons of each filter type will help you select the best option for your specific hard water issues and daily needs.
